1. Start Your Adventure: The Main Square and Government Palace 🏛️
Every good adventure starts with a grand entrance, and Lima’s Main Square (Plaza de Armas) is just that. Surrounded by the Government Palace, the Cathedral of Lima, and the Archbishop’s Palace, this square is a perfect blend of colonial elegance and modern life. 🏺✨
Tip: Arrive early to avoid the crowds and capture some stunning photos. Don’t forget to check out the ornate fountains and the beautiful tile work. 📸
2. Explore the Wonders: San Francisco Monastery and Catacombs 🕊️
No trip to Lima’s historic center is complete without a visit to the San Francisco Monastery. This 17th-century architectural gem is not only a religious site but also a museum housing an impressive collection of art and artifacts. 📚🎨
The highlight? The catacombs beneath the monastery, where you can explore the eerie yet fascinating underground burial chambers. It’s a bit macabre, but totally worth it! 🕰️🔍
Pro tip: Join a guided tour to get the full historical context and some spooky stories. 🧙♂️
3. Savor the Flavors: Mercado de Surquillo 🍅🍲
After all that history, it’s time to refuel with some delicious Peruvian cuisine. Head to the Mercado de Surquillo, one of Lima’s most famous markets. From fresh seafood to traditional dishes like ceviche and lomo saltado, your taste buds will thank you. 🍤🌶️
Don’t miss the juice stands offering a variety of exotic fruits like lucuma and maracuya. It’s a refreshing way to cool off after a busy morning. 🍹☀️
4. Art and Culture: Museo de Arte de Lima (MALI) 🖼️🎭
For a deeper dive into Peruvian art and culture, the Museo de Arte de Lima (MALI) is a must-visit. The museum houses a vast collection of pre-Columbian, colonial, and contemporary art, providing a comprehensive overview of Peru’s artistic heritage. 🎨📜
Fun fact: MALI often hosts temporary exhibitions and workshops, so check their schedule before you go. You might catch a unique exhibit or even participate in a hands-on activity. 🎭
5. Relax and Reflect: Parque de la Reserva 🌳🌊
After a day of exploring, unwind at Parque de la Reserva. This large park offers a peaceful escape from the city’s hustle and bustle. Take a leisurely stroll, enjoy the fountains, and maybe even catch a performance at the outdoor amphitheater. 🎤🌳
If you’re visiting in the evening, don’t miss the Magic Circuit of Water, a series of illuminated water fountains that create a mesmerizing light show. It’s a magical way to end your day. 🌟💧
